I am trying to use Joomla!'s article system to create some content for my site.

However, when I publish the article and view it, all of the SP Page Builder created content is all smashed together and not displaying like a normal SP Page Builder page.

How can I make articles created with SP Page Builder display just like an SP Page Builder Page?

I have added this css code one of article details page and it lookis nice.

.article-details {
    max-width: 100% !important;
}

.itemid-380 .container {
    max-width: 100%;
}
